An Act amending the special act charter of the city of Northampton to allow resident non-citizens to vote in preliminary and city elections
This bill amends Northampton's city charter to allow non-citizen residents to vote in local city elections. It directly affects non-citizen residents living in Northampton who are not disqualified under state law. The key provision removes citizenship requirements for voting in preliminary, special, and regular city elections, including elections for ward councilors and school committee members. The change applies only to local city elections, not state or federal elections. The bill updates the city's voting qualifications section to explicitly include noncitizens as eligible voters.
